15/11/2015 : VARIOUS ARTISTS - Seminar1sts, The Agnost1k Era

VARIOUS ARTISTS

Seminar1sts, The Agnost1k Era

MusicCD
CybergothIndustrialNoise

[70/100]   

Agnost1k Records.
15/11/2015, William LIÉNARD

EN

After a silence of more than a year, the Swiss label Agnost1k Records returns with a new release. In the past, the label frocused on industrial hardcore, but in Seminar1sts, The Agnost1k Era the palette is broadened, with space for rythmic noize, industrial techno and even IDM and ambient music with an industrial character. For this new CD album work is selected from the hardcore scene (Fiend, USA) and the industrial/rhythmic noise scene (Mono-Amine, the Netherlands), but also by well-known artists such as Iszloscope, The Relic, Sarrin Assault and newcomers like Demanufacturer and Synaptic Memories.


The thirteen compositions of Seminarists, The Agnost1k Era are noisy, loud, very rhythmic and destined for the dance floor, though you will not hear them at Tomorrowland or rave parties, because the sounds are very dark and mostly industrial and targeted at lovers of cyber goth and related types of music. We don’t fee addressed by Seminar1sts, The Agnost1k Era, but it sounds very contagious at times, though there is a certain monotony due to the many similarities between the tracks, but of course that also applies to other genres as well.

We are very impressed with the work of newcomer Demanufacturer (Volcano), the solid sound of Billy S. & AK-Industry (Mechanic Sin), the noise of Embrionyc (Just Another Noisy Loop) and the overpowering Mental Monologue by Mono-Amine. But for lovers of this kind of music, this compilation eventually contains 12 interesting contributions. We like to draw your very special attention to Closing Chapter of Billy S., a stranger on the album, but very beautiful!
